Founder of S&M Custom Design LLC Santia McKoy spoke on the late actor’s profound influence on her life since the debut of the first “Black Panther” film. Santa McKoy, owner of S&M Unique Design LLC in Ocoee, has created another innovative, one-of-a-kind custom design.
The outfit is from the designer’s La Vie En Noir line and is a memorial to the late actor Chadwick Boseman. McKoy said it meant the world to her and the African American community to witness Boseman in the role of Black Panther in the movie. She claimed that the actor had made quite an impression on her ever since she first saw the film.
Many of her admirers urged her to see the film because ‘Designer Santia you have to go see the movie because the designs they are wearing are something that you can make,'” she explained. “I went in watching the movie while at the same time my vision is putting me in action where I can see myself making all these clothes.”
According to the designer, the garment was handcrafted in roughly a week. The velvet and sequins on the dress are a one-of-a-kind design. Similar to the one Black Panther wore in the film, this necklace is made out of claws.

In her words, “it’s really amazing in many ways to have a black man playing such an important position, portraying a monarch that reflected so much culture.” “When I heard of his passing, I felt like a large piece of our community had been ripped away. I was profoundly moved by his influence.”
Unfortunately, Boseman lost his fight against colon cancer on August 28th, 2020. According to McKoy, “my fantasy was to meet him and design some outfits for him.” This desire persisted long after the actor’s death. “That news just sucked the wind out of me. I promised myself, “I will make a masterpiece in his honor.”
On Friday, November 11, theaters everywhere will show the highly anticipated sequel to Marvel’s Black Panther. McKoy has stated that in September of 2023, she will be making a trip to New York to attend New York Fashion Week.
